What affects the price

When you look at replacing windows, the final number depends on a few moving parts. The biggest factor is the frame material—vinyl is usually the most budget-friendly, while wood or fiberglass carries a higher price tag. The style of window also matters; a simple double-hung unit costs less to install than a large bay or bow window. You will also want to consider the glass packages, like double versus triple pane, which affect energy efficiency. Complexity of the job, such as needing lead paint remediation or structural repairs, can add to the total.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What's the difference between a window installation and an AC unit installation?

Window installation involves replacing or fitting a new window into a wall opening. This focuses on the glass, frame, and sealing for insulation and light. Window air conditioning unit installation involves fitting an appliance into an existing window opening to cool a room. The AC unit is a separate appliance with its own electrical needs, whereas a window installation is about the building structure itself. Both require professional attention for proper function.
